Конфликт флажков двух форм в JavaScript

  • Автор темы dstillermann
  • 25
  • Обновлено
  • 15, May 2024
  • #1
У меня есть две контактные формы: одна находится в include/footer.php и одна на contact.php, и когда на странице контактов я попытаюсь отправить форму в нижнем колонтитуле, она не будет отправлена, потому что я получил проверку флажка на каждой форма, в которой пользователь должен согласиться с условиями перед отправкой формы, поэтому попробовал следующее, но ни одна форма по-прежнему не отправляется, если оба флажка не установлены.

код флажка формы в footer.php приведен ниже

Я прочитал и согласен с Политикой конфиденциальности

MM PC Solutions

<скрипт>

$(".needs-validation").submit(function(e){

if(!$("#agreefooter").is(":checked")){

alert('Пожалуйста, укажите, что вы прочитали Политику конфиденциальности MM PC Solutions');

е.preventDefault();

}

});

Код флажка формы на странице контактов приведен ниже.

Я прочитал и согласен с Политикой конфиденциальности

MM PC Solutions <скрипт>

$(".Контактная форма необходимости проверки").submit(function(e){

if(!$("#agreecontact").is(":checked")){

alert('Пожалуйста, укажите, что вы прочитали Политику конфиденциальности MM PC Solutions');

е.preventDefault();

}

});

Может ли кто-нибудь помочь, пожалуйста, чтобы формы не конфликтовали и позволяли мне отправить форму, если в какой-либо форме не установлен флажок?

Надеюсь, это имеет смысл

dstillermann


Рег
01 Jan, 2011

Тем
1

Постов
2

Баллов
12
Тем
49554
Комментарии
57426
Опыт
552966

Интересно